Lift trucks are really dangerous machines. Statistics by OSHA show that about 100 warehouse employees are killed every year in lift truck mishaps while they are operating them. An extra 95,000 workers are hurt on the job every year as well, utilizing these heavy pieces of industrial machinery.

Nearly all fatalities have been because of forklift turnovers. Being crushed between the forklift and another surface is the next highest percentage of fatalities. The third highest cause of death is being struck by the forklift itself and last but not least, getting hit from falling things due to a dropped load is the last statistic. Every fatality or injury is quite terrible and gruesome due to the capability and immense weight of these machines.

Who Should Conduct the Training?
All assessment and teaching needs to be taught by people who have the appropriate education, experience and knowledge to train powered industrial truck drivers the correct skills and then to evaluate their competence after that. Several examples of a qualified trainer consist of a person who has a certificate, specialized degree or professional standing in their possession, or who has extensive training, experience and knowledge utilizing lift trucks. A good candidate has lots of practice and has shown the capability to evaluate and train operators of industrial trucks.

There are resources accessible to choose from if their employer does not want to perform the training themselves. For example, they could employ in local health and safety organizations, like for example truck manufacturers, the National Safety Council local chapters, or private teaching consultants who specialize in powered industrial trucks. There are usually local trade and vocational schools that will be really glad to offer some great resources.

There are many sites on the World Wide Web that are dedicated to lift truck safety. Private companies can be found on line which provide lift truck safety training services, such as videos and written programs. Nearly all safety videos could either be rented or leased or bought. One important factor to think about is that simply by showing your employees a video or a series of videos on lift truck safety, does not meet the full requirements of the OSHA standard. Subsequent training and knowledge of the new drivers must be conveyed and evaluated by a specific method so as to make sure that the full training has been acquired.

When the driver has successfully passed all of the necessary training, a lift truck license will be given and they will legally be able to drive a forklift. Valid lift truck licenses are a requirement by organizations to be able to keep everybody at the workplace really safe.
